Bhutanese menβs folk costume is charismatic and unusual. You definitely notice the shoes β beautifully adorned works of art. But the whole attire sure will draw a look. It consists of an under jacket called βtegoβ, a robe called βghoβ, a fabric belt called βkeraβ, a large silk scarf called βkabneyβ, and boots called βtshog lhamβ. We would like to show you these garments and the whole costume and add some curious details about it.
Tego
First of all, under the gho, men wear a βtegoβ. It is a long-sleeved short jacket. Women also wear it under the kira.
Gho
The gho is a Bhutanese male ethnic clothing. The wearing of the βghoβ for men and βkiraβ for women is only a small part of the βdriglam namzhaβ (official dress code of Bhutan). The gho is a knee-length robe tied at the waist with a βkeraβ β hand-woven fabric belt. Bhutanese people began to wear the gho in the 17th century. Today, the local men use this attire for formal occasions; the government representatives are obliged to wear the gho for work.
Kera
The kera belt is folded in such a way that a big pocket is formed in front of the abdomen. And this is actually used to store things in. This is, perhaps, the largest pocket in the world.
Kabney In Bhutan, the βkabneyβ β a silk scarf β is worn with the Gho. The size of a kabney traditionally is 90x300 cm (35x118 inches). This scarf is draped over the left shoulder and the right hip. Kabney is a symbol that signifies different groups of professions as there are different colors and designs of kabney for different professions. For instance, saffron color is for the king or chief abbot, orange is for government officials, green β for judges, white β for ordinary citizens, etc.
